YAHWEH'S
PERFECT LAW
It
is Sunday morning. Minister Johnson climbs onto the podium, turns to
Romans 10:4, and proclaims good news by announcing, "The
Savior paid it all. We are free from those Old Testament regulations
and now are under grace through faith alone!"
Many
in nominal worship today believe and proclaim this same message —
that Yahushua the Messiah has "nailed the Law to the cross."
How much of this belief is true, however? Has the Law been nailed to
the stake or does Yahweh’s Law remain in effect for His New
Covenant believers?
Let
us examine some popular New Covenant passages cited by those who
would abolish Biblical law.
WHAT
WAS ADDED?
Many
point to a passage in Colossians as proof that Yahushua did away with
the Old Testament Laws. Here Paul writes,
"Blotting
out the handwriting of ordinances that was against us, which was
contrary to us, and took it out of the way, nailing it to his cross"
(Col. 2:14).
(KJV)
With
an understanding of the Greek word "ordinances" in this
verse, we find another meaning. The Greek word here is No. 1378,
dogma.
Strong’s
Exhaustive Concordance Greek
Dictionary defines dogma as: "from the base 1380; a law (civil,
cerem., or eccl.): — decree, ordinance."
Colossians
2:14 “Having blotted out the
certificate of debt against us – by
the dogmas – which stood
against us. And He has taken it out of the way, having nailed it to
the stake.” (The Scriptures 1998)
Dogma
is found seven times in the New Testament and refers to man-made
decrees. One authority writes, "As the form of error at Colosse
was largely Judaic, insisting on Jewish ceremonial law, the phrase is
probably coloured by this fact," Word Studies in the New
Covenant, p. 908.
Thus,
dogma here is not signifying Yahweh’s Law, but man-made decrees
or
ordinances. Paul was referring to the added law, which the Jews
tacked on to Yahweh’s Torah. We find the Apostle Paul warning
Titus
of this added law:
Titus
1:14
“Not paying attention to
Yehudite fables, and commands of
men who turn from the truth."
Yahweh
was not always pleased with these added laws. Yahushua chastised the
Jews in Matthew 15
and Mark 8
for their "commands of
men", which here meant eating with
unwashed hands. The Jews made many physical commandments, but they
neglected the spiritual aspect of Yahweh’s Law, and that is what
displeased Yahushua.
THE
TELOS OF THE LAW
In
Romans 10:4 we have a passage that is misconstrued by a
majority of preachers today:
Romans 10:4
For Christ is
the end of the law for righteousness to every one that believeth.”
(KJV)
On
the surface it may appear as if Yahushua ended the law for everyone
when He died on the stake. Does that harmonize with the rest of
Yahweh’s Word, however? Are we now living lawlessly? If so, then
we
have no sin because "sin is not imputed
when there is no law," Romans 5:13. But that cannot be,
because Paul also wrote, "All have sinned
and come short of the esteem of Yahweh," Romans 3:23. Is
something missing here that most don’t see?
The
Greek word for "end"
in this passage is telos,
and telos is defined in Strong’s Greek
Dictionary as: "to set out for a definite point or goal, the
point aimed at as a limit" — No. 5056.
This
word "end" found in Romans
10:4 would be better translated
"goal".
We find a better rendition of this verse in “The Scriptures
1998”,
which reads:
Romans
10:4 For Messiah
is the goal
of the ‘Torah unto righteousness’to everyone who
believes.”
(The Scriptures)
In
James
5
the same Greek word telos
is
translated "end":
"…you
have seen the end
[telos]
of
the Lord
(YHWH)."
(KJV). Has Yahweh come to an end? Of course not, and neither has the
law. Both Yahweh and the law have goals, not ending points. We will
now look at an important goal of the law.
NO
LONGER UNDER A SCHOOLMASTER
Galatians
is one of the most troublesome Books for many in today’s
religious
circles. In Galatians 3 we have a passage that has been misunderstood
by the major populace today.
Galatians
3:24-25
“Wherefore the law was our schoolmaster to
bring us
unto
Christ, that we might be justified by faith. 25
But
after that faith is come, we are no longer under a schoolmaster.”
(KJV)
This verse
is not difficult to understand if we consider some key facts.
We
saw in Romans
10:4 that the
Messiah is not the end of the Law, but the goal at which the law
aims. Messiah is the object or purpose for the Law. Only through the
Law can we know Messiah, because Yahushua literally represents the
Law in flesh. He lived the law in every aspect. If we do the same, we
will be like the Messiah.
Galatians
3:24-25
“Therefore the Torah became our trainer unto Messiah, in order to
be declared right by belief. 25
And after belief has come, we are no longer under a trainer.”
(The Scriptures 1998)
Paul
is saying that through the Torah we know Messiah, but after we have
come to the knowledge of Yahushua we no longer need a schoolmaster,
because the Law is part of us now, as is the Messiah.
In
the Greek culture a schoolmaster was a paidagogos,
a trustworthy slave who had the guardianship of the boys of a
household. They needed him for guidance and instruction while they
were young. But after they grew up, they lived by the precepts he
taught them. It became second nature to do what they had been taught.
They would no longer need the schoolmaster once they learned "the
rules." This is the point Paul was making with the law.
Through
belief we comply with Yahweh’s will automatically. His precepts
and
laws are now part of us. We no longer need a strict schoolmaster
guiding our every thought and action because doing the right thing is
second nature.
